I am having a destination wedding in Jamaica in May on the beach. I want to create a fan that will serve as a program, keep sake fan for my guest. I have researched vendors;however, some want to charge me $200 to create a template for an order of 60 fans. That is outrageous to me and now I am trying to figure out how I can do this myself. Does anyone know where I can get the paper needed to create a fan as well as the wooden stick. Are there any wholesale dealers? If any of you know of one please send me their contact information or send me the store I can go to as well as the item i need to purschase. Thanking you in advance. Happy Sunday

    I made my own. Buy the fans from oriental trading ($10 for 12) and the cards from vistaprint (25 free).

    email me if you need details.

    I think you could get nice cardstock from staples and be able to do it yourself. my friend did that. and she hot glued popsicle sticks on the back..so they look like the ones you get at the county fair..it was really neat..ppl likeed them alot.

    Yes I googled (fan ceremony programs templates) and I printed them out on cardstock paper. Its a pain cutting so much but it will save you a lot of money and they are cute...the sight that came up for my design was www.ayleebits.com. Hope this helps
